Seeds should be planted about 1 to 2 inches apart and roughly 1/4 to 1/2 inch deep. Thin seedlings to about 6 to 8 inches apart. Cilantro is a leafy green herb that grows in bunches and has a pungent taste and a strong aroma. It has long, jagged leaves and has a bright green color. Coriander is a small brown-colored seed that has a sweet flavor and a mild aroma. It is usually ground and used in powder form.
